<pre wrap="">Hi all,
I want to provide an initial solution to hotstart Cbc. For this purpoose, I use
model.setHotstartSolution(startx);
In the output, I do not see anything if the solution is acceptted or
not. Does Cbc accept partial solution? For example: does Cbc solve an
lp after fixing integer variables to current values for hot start
solution?
The other feature I use is solution pool of Cbc. For this purpose I set
model.setMaximumSavedSolutions(10);
But it seems like these two features do not work in harmony together.
I get valgrind errors.
